Shimenawa (rice rope) One of the most striking symbols of Shinto is the rice rope used to denote sacred space, called Shimenawa. The earliest rites of Shinto are generally held to be associated with the introduction of rice culture in the Yayoi Age (300 BC - 250 AD), and as the staple food rice was treasured as a gift from the gods. Shimenawa (注連縄, enclosing rope) are strands of rice straw rope used for ritual purification in Shinto, usually decorated with shide (紙垂), zigzag-shaped paper streamers. It is believed that something adorned or surrounded with Shimenawa is a sacred location or object. In the Shinto religion, twists of sacred rice straw rope called Shimenawa are used to symbolize ritual purification and to ward off evil spirits. The Shimenawa is hung over the doors of temples, homes or building sites after they have been purified. The rope is also used to encircle objects that are considered holy, such as trees or rocks. The Shimenawa is believed to have the power to purify and protect sacred spaces and objects. It is thought to be a barrier that separates the sacred from the profane. In Shinto practice, the Shimenawa is used to mark off the area around the kami, or the spirits, that are worshipped at Shinto shrines. A Shimenawa rope is the border that separates a Japanese shrine from the outside world. Beyond merely being a physical marker showing the boundary of the shrine and the outside, Shimenawa sacred ropes also serve to protect the gods' space inside the shrine from any corrupt element of the outside world. It creates a space both to welcome a god. Shimenawa and Shimekazari 注連縄と注連飾り A Shimenawa is a rope that separates a sacred area from the outside world, and one of the marks that draws a boundary. For this reason, Shimenawa are stretched around shrines, sacred objects, sacred trees, and other places that are considered sacred areas.
